Property is located in the High Desert area of E. San Diego County in the In-Ko-)Pah Mountains. 5 camp sites to choose from and one (1) glamping unit "Casa Agave" which is a small home the sleeps four (4). One queen bed, 1 single and a sofa bed that sleeps one. To the west is Table Mountain a sacred Native American Ceremonial Ground that is on BLM land. The Northern boundary is the beginning Anza Borrego State Park. The East and South borders are private land. There is much evidence of campsites and artifacts that the land used to be inhabited by the Kumeyaay Nation. Mica and Garnets used to be mined in this area as well. The property is a transitional area where agave, juniper and scrub oak thrive. Wildlife in the area includes: Quail, Rattle Snakes, Lizards, Ravens, Roadrunners, Tarantulas, Rosy Boa, Mule Deer, Pack Rats, Bob Cats, Coyotes and at times Bighorn Sheep are spotted by Table Mountain. Various unique homes and trailers are spread throughout Bombay Beach. Bombay Beach, California, is a tiny, offbeat community on the eastern shore of the Salton Sea. Once a mid-century vacation hotspot, it now stands as a surreal desert outpost where the decaying remnants of its glamorous past meet striking, experimental art installations. Known for its haunting beauty, stark landscapes, and vibrant creative scene, Bombay Beach attracts artists, dreamers, and curious travelers seeking an otherworldly blend of nostalgia and avant-garde culture.

Yellow Woman Ranch is a women's retreat and event center in the remote town of Borrego Springs, surrounded by the Anza-Borrego Desert State Park. The ranch sits on four and a half acres and offers expansive 360° mountain views, including Indian Head and the Santa Rosa Mountains, visible from the ranch's new contemplative garden and meditation circle. Borrego Springs is a designated dark-sky community, providing clear, unobstructed views of the cosmos. Currently, we are offering two types of lodging: 1.
